            BArch, RM 3/3008 · File · 1889-1894
            Part of Federal Archives (Archivtektonik)

            Contains among other things: Report of the Governor of Cameroon on the state and training of local police forces from Sept. 1892 Report of mutiny of the police forces in Cameroon, request for a warship and people, preparation for shipment of ammunition and weapons there in Dec. 1893/Jan. 1894 Transparent contract between Reichsmarineamt Berlin and the Deutsche-Ost-Afrika-Linie Hamburg for the transport of people to Cameroon with the steamship "Admiral" on 8 Jan. 1894

            German Imperial Naval Office
            BArch, N 38/5 · File · 13. Mai 1904 - 11. März 1905
            Part of Federal Archives (Archivtektonik)

            Contains: Battle reports of the GenLt. v. Trotha, commander-in-chief for German South-West Africa, Aug. 9 - 12, 1904; newspaper illustrations of GenLt. v. v. Trotha and his Offz.; passenger list of the steamship Eleonore Woermann, 20 May 1904; travel experiences Arnold Lequis from South West Africa

            Lequis, Arnold
            BArch, RM 2/1758 · File · 1911-1913
            Part of Federal Archives (Archivtektonik)

            Contains among other things: Mutiny on the German steamer "Lotte Menzell" (report SMS "Hertha", transcript), Oct. 1912 Scientific expedition on the Empress Augusta River in German New Guinea (report SMS "Condor" with 11 photos, transcript), Jan. 1913 Unrest in Liberia - Protection of the German population by SMS "Bremen", "Eber" and "Panther". (Report SMS "Bremen", transcript), Jan. 1913
